  • Installment twelve from our COVID-19 Sessions recorded live March 17, 19, and 20.
    “Be like the bird that, pausing in her flight awhile on boughs too slight, feels them give way beneath her -- and sings -- knowing she hath wings.”
    ----
    Abbie Betinis' "Be Like the Bird," with text from Victor Hugo is a song we originally performed on this past year’s Christmas program. It was one of the pieces we were most excited about revisiting for our COVID-19 Sessions.
    We hope that Abbie’s intention combined with this cultural moment and our performance setting underground will have special resonance for you. Here is Abbie’s program note in full:
    “I wrote this canon just after completing cancer treatment for the second time. My family and I sent it out as our annual Christmas card in 2009. And -- while I couldn't have foreseen it at the time -- it would turn into my mantra over the next year, while I underwent a third cancer diagnosis and bone marrow transplant.
    My cousin Sarah Riley and I discovered the text quite by accident. In October 2009, our grandfather, the Rt. Rev. John H. Burt (a.k.a Christmas reveler and merry-maker, lover of music and literature, and inspiring leader and activist) had died. After his funeral, and after an impromptu family round-sing (common in the Burt family), Sarah and I were sitting on Grandpa's old couch, reading through some of the sermons he had written and delivered throughout his long life. Sarah is co-director of an incredible program called High Rocks, a comprehensive and unique school for girls founded by her mom, Susan Burt, in the mountains of rural West Virginia.
    Sarah and I realized that Grandpa had quoted this lovely Victor Hugo text in a few sermons over the years, always to inspire courage in the face of adversity. It struck me as a surprisingly hopeful text befitting a difficult year, but it also moved me to tears to think of the work that my Aunt Susie and now my cousin herself, sitting there next to me on the couch, are doing to change the world -- one girl at a time.
    So I dedicate this carol to High Rocks for Girls. May High Rocks continue to educate, empower, and inspire each girl to know that "she hath wings."
